Welcome ~ Wilkommen ~ Bienvenidos

At Albert Einstein Academies, we are delighted to welcome your child to a joyful and engaging Transitional Kindergarten experience. Our program is thoughtfully designed to nurture the whole child through meaningful play, inquiry, and relationships, creating a strong foundation for lifelong learning.

We believe that play is the work of childhood. Through purposeful, play-based learning, children explore their interests, solve problems, collaborate with others, and develop the confidence to take risks in a supportive environment. Research shows that play is one of the most effective ways for young children to build the executive functioning skills they need for future success, including planning, organizing, communicating, self-regulation, and flexible thinking.

As an International Baccalaureate (IB) World School, our classrooms are guided by the IB Learner Profile, encouraging children to become caring, curious, reflective, open-minded, and principled members of our learning community. These attributes are woven throughout each day as students learn about themselves, build meaningful relationships with others, and develop an appreciation for the diverse world around them.

Our learning is organized around engaging IB Units of Inquiry, which invite children to ask questions, investigate big ideas, and make real-world connections across subject areas. Families are an essential part of this journey, and many of our classroom explorations continue at home through conversations, activities, and shared experiences that strengthen the connection between school and family life.

Together, we create a nurturing environment where every child is known, valued, and inspired to grow academically, socially, emotionally, and linguistically. Thank you for partnering with AEA as we embark on this exciting year of discovery, wonder, and learning together.

TK Welcome Tea Event: 

Save the Date Friday, August 7, 2026, 9:45 am – 10:30 am

It is an AEA tradition to have a TK/ Kinder Tea on the Friday prior to the start of school. This is an opportunity for our newest Einstein students to learn a German song, meet their teachers, see their classrooms, and receive their special Schultüte. This year, due to ongoing construction and less space, we will stagger the classes into two groups and start our event in our new MPR before moving to the classrooms, and then ending on the playground area.
